Marijuana Legalization in US and Europe for Medical and Personal Use (2024)

As more and more states are embracing marijuana legalization, I've discovered a fascinating trend sweeping across many regions. The rise of marijuana legalization is driven by a combination of factors, but in my viewpoint, I believe marijuana legalization is expanding due to two primary reasons.

 

Top 2 Reasons Why More Places Are Legalizing Marijuana

1. Shifting Perceptions

Firstly, shifting perceptions play a pivotal role. Over time, there's been a remarkable shift in societal attitudes toward cannabis, largely fueled by increasing research showcasing its medicinal benefits. This evolving perception has paved the way for greater acceptance of legalization initiatives.

2. Economic Opportunities

Secondly, economic opportunities abound in the cannabis industry. Governments worldwide are beginning to recognize the immense economic potential of legalizing cannabis. This includes not only job creation but also the generation of substantial tax revenue and the stimulation of ancillary industries.

Is weed legal in Montana?

  • Recreational Growing: Legal (as of 2021)
  • Medical Growing: Legal
  • Plant Limits: Up to four plants per household for personal use. (Adults may cultivate up to two mature marijuana plants and two seedlings for private use in a private residence, subject to certain restrictions. (Medical marijuana cardholders may cultivate up to four mature plants and four seedlings). The plants may not be visible to the public.
  • Notes: Legalization for both recreational and medical use was passed in 2021.
